3. Ukuhambisana Kwesistimu

The LUX Pro PSD111B thermostat is designed for use with most 24-volt gas, oil, or electric heating and air conditioning systems, gas millivolt heating systems, and single-stage heat pumps. It is not compatible with 120-volt heating systems or two-stagamaphampu okushisa.

Compatible Systems (24V)

  • Gas/Oil/Electric Furnace - Heating only
  • Gas/Oil/Electric Furnace - Single Stage
  • Iphampu Yokushisa ngaphandle Kokushisa Okuyisizayo
  • 2-wire Hydronic (Hot Water)
  • 750 Millivolt
  • Gas Fireplaces (24V)
  • Ukupholisa kuphela
  • Abangashadile stage Ukupholisa

Ayihambisani Ne

  • Heat Pump Multistage
  • Radiant Ceiling Heat
  • Electric Baseboards
  • Iphampu Yokushisa Nokushisa Okusizayo
  • Portable space heaters
  • 3-wire Hydronic (Hot Water)
  • Gas/Oil/Electric Furnace - Multistage
  • Cool Multistage
  • Plug-in air conditioners

5. Ukusetha nokufakwa

Before beginning installation, ensure the power to your HVAC system is turned off at the circuit breaker to prevent electrical shock or damage to the system.

5.1 Ukukhweza iThermostat

  1. Carefully remove your old thermostat. Take a photo of the existing wiring connections for reference.
  2. Mount the new thermostat base plate to the wall using the provided screws and anchors. The thermostat can be installed in either horizontal or vertical orientation.
  3. Feed wires through the back of the thermostat base and securely mount to the wall with supplied screws and anchors.
Image showing the thermostat in both horizontal and vertical mounting positions, highlighting its large backlit display, dual power options, and 5-year warranty.

Umfanekiso 5: Izinketho Zokufaka

5.2 Izintambo Iziyalezo

Refer to the wiring diagrams below for typical hookups. Use the provided wire labels to correctly identify and connect wires from your HVAC system to the corresponding terminals on the thermostat base.

Wiring diagram for Heating and Cooling Systems with one transformer and two transformers.

Figure 6: Typical Wiring Diagrams

Detailed wiring diagrams for various thermostat hookups including 2-wire heat, 3-wire heat, 4-wire heating and cooling, 5-wire heating and cooling, and single stagfutha wokushisa.

Figure 7: Detailed Wiring Hookups

5.3 Gas/Electric System Selection

Locate the small switch inside the thermostat unit. Slide the switch to the 'GAS' position for gas heating systems or 'ELEC' for electric heating systems (including heat pumps).

5.4 Ukufakwa kwebhethri

Insert the two AA alkaline batteries into the battery compartment located at the bottom of the thermostat. Ensure correct polarity. Remove any protective tabs if present.

5.5 Umhlangano Wokugcina

Once wiring and settings are complete, carefully snap the thermostat front cover onto the mounted base plate. Restore power to your HVAC system at the circuit breaker.

8. Ukuxazulula izinkinga

If your thermostat is not functioning as expected, consider the following:

  • Akukho Ukuboniswa: Hlola ukuthi amabhethri afakwe kahle yini futhi ashaje ngokwanele. Shintsha uma kudingeka.
  • Isistimu Ayiphenduli: Ensure the SYSTEM switch is set to HEAT or COOL, not OFF. Verify the fan switch is in the desired position (AUTO or ON). Check your circuit breaker for the HVAC system.
  • Ukufunda Kwezinga Lokushisa Okungalungile: Allow the thermostat to acclimate to the room temperature for at least 15 minutes after installation or significant temperature changes.
  • Heating/Cooling Cycles Too Frequently/Infrequently: Adjust the temperature swing settings (9-step control) to fine-tune the cycle frequency.
